ILLM.TO
illumin Holdings Inc
Price:  
1.03 
CAD
Volume:  
348,210.00
Canada | Interactive Media & Services
Valuation
Overview
Financials
Forecast
Compare
Historical Price
SolvencyDividends
Transactions
People

ILLM.TO EV/EBITDA

-37.9%
Upside

As of 2026-01-01, the EV/EBITDA ratio of illumin Holdings Inc (ILLM.TO) is -3.78. EV/EBITDA ratio is calculated by dividing the enterprise value by the TTM EBITDA. ILLM.TO's latest enterprise value is 14.88 mil CAD. ILLM.TO's TTM EBITDA according to its financial statements is -3.93 mil CAD. Dividing these 2 quantities gives us the above ILLM.TO EV/EBITDA ratio.

Range Selected
Trailing P/E multiples 4.0x - 5.0x 4.0x
Forward P/E multiples 5.8x - 12.6x 7.2x
Fair Price 0.44 - 0.92 0.64
Upside -57.5% - -10.9% -37.9%
1.03 CAD
Stock Price
0.64 CAD
Fair Price

ILLM.TO EV/EBITDA - Historical EV/EBITDA Data

Date EV/EBITDA
2025-12-31 -3.91
2025-12-30 -3.78
2025-12-29 -3.78
2025-12-24 -3.78
2025-12-23 -4.05
2025-12-22 -4.18
2025-12-19 -4.97
2025-12-18 -3.78
2025-12-17 -3.65
2025-12-16 -3.13
2025-12-15 -3.26
2025-12-12 -3.26
2025-12-11 -3.13
2025-12-10 -3.13
2025-12-09 -2.86
2025-12-08 -2.86
2025-12-05 -3.13
2025-12-04 -3.26
2025-12-03 -3.26
2025-12-02 -3.00
2025-12-01 -2.86
2025-11-28 -3.13
2025-11-27 -3.13
2025-11-26 -3.00
2025-11-25 -2.73
2025-11-24 -3.13
2025-11-21 -3.00
2025-11-20 -3.39
2025-11-19 -3.13
2025-11-18 -3.39
2025-11-17 -4.05
2025-11-14 -3.52
2025-11-13 -3.78
2025-11-12 -3.65
2025-11-11 -3.91
2025-11-10 -3.91
2025-11-07 -3.39
2025-11-06 -4.97
2025-11-05 -4.70
2025-11-04 -4.83
2025-11-03 -6.15
2025-10-31 -6.15
2025-10-30 -5.75
2025-10-29 -6.02
2025-10-28 -6.94
2025-10-27 -6.80
2025-10-24 -7.33
2025-10-23 -7.33
2025-10-22 -6.94
2025-10-21 -6.94